Birgunj Customs Office collects Rs 73.18 billion in revenue from petroleum products
Δημοσιευμένα

BIRGUNJ: The Birgunj Customs Office has collected Rs 73.18 billion in revenue from the import of petroleum products during the first 11 months of the current fiscal year, making it the highest single source of income for the office.
